1. Partner With Local Businesses

Partnering with local businesses can be a great way to develop new revenue channels for your hotel. By working with them, you could offer excursions to your guests, which benefits you and the companies you partner with.

With this approach, you could offer discounted services for these excursions while getting a commission from the businesses you work with. If there are paid activities close to your hotel, it’s worth looking into partnering with them.

By working with different types of companies, you’ll have more than enough to interest all of your guests. It’ll increase your hotel revenues more than you’d think.

2. Promote Upsells

Your hotel has more opportunities to upsell than you might be aware of. You’ll not only need to know about these, but also to take advantage of them. Promote them as much as possible, and train employees to properly sell them.

Some of the more notable upsells you can use are:

  • Parking fees
  • Shuttle transportation
  • Gift store
  • Pet fees

By taking advantage of these and promoting them as much as you can, you’ll increase hotel revenues more than you’d expect. While not every customer will use them, more than a few will, boosting your overall revenues. They’re worth considering.
